In gambling, some people will wager their lives away despite the odds. In Katie Cunningham’s novel Nicotine Dreams she tells of one woman’s struggle with the uncontrollable call of the casino and the sacrifices she will make to stay in the game.

Meet Kim, a fairly ordinary, middle-aged woman with a job, two adult children, and a difficult husband. For enjoyment, she plays the stock market, buys expensive handbags and sneaks an occasional cigarette. But when a casino opens within driving distance of her house, her life as she knows it will soon be over.

This is a story of addiction. This is a story of Kim’s descent into gambling hell, where the compulsion to play slots and poker machines is so great, she will risk it all in order to place just one more bet.

The author lives in Chaska, Minnesota with her two dogs, Sprout and Elmo. Her website is www.nicotinedreams.com.
